ADTAC - Advanced Diploma Programme in Technical & Analytical Chemistry
18 months full-time programme recognised by the Maharashtra State Board of Technical Education (MSBTE) - Government of Maharashtra.

Sharp Opportunities

Type of industries and capacity in which ADTAC students get employment

Wage employment / Opportunities
Chemical, pharmaceutical, food and paint industries in which quality control activity is carried out for raw, intermediate and finished products
  • Analysts
  • Chemists
  • Q.C. Chemists
Analytical laboratories
  • Analysts
  • Chemists

Self employment / Opportunities
To start own laboratory with approval by FDA and MSCB (Maharashtra State Pollution Control Board) to carry out analysis as per the recommended standards for various products as well as for water and industrial effluents
  • Self employment

Job functions of ADTAC students

Position Function
Analysts To carry analysis of various product samples such as pharmaceuticals, food, oil, petroleum products, paper - pulp, coal, water, industrial effluents, cosmetics etc.
Chemists To do all the job functions as stated above as well as he/ she has to supervise the methods employed are per the I.S.I., F.D.A., G.M. etc. and also supervise the routine functions of instruments
Senior Chemists Planning and supervising the work and analysis carried out and also check the proper functioning of instruments
Q.C /Q.A
Asst. Manager
Planning and analysis, and doing overall surveillance of the quality control activities
